When people think of breweries from America’s Northeast, big-name companies like Sam Adams and Yuengling come to mind and not smaller, craft breweries. However, overlooking these smaller businesses means missing out on quality, small-batch brews. One of the best states in the Northeast for craft breweries is New Hampshire, which, with 93 such businesses within its borders as of 2020, sits in eighth place in terms of breweries per capita. If you decide to visit The Granite State for your next pint the small town of Londonderry, with three great craft breweries within its limits, is an essential stop.
